Celebrate a golden era of music and laughter as we remember the songs and stars of the 'fabulous fifties' and 'swinging sixties!'

This sparkling, foot-tapping, feel-good show evokes the wonderful mix of entertainment that accompanied the optimistic youth of the postwar generation, and is packed with nearly fifty singalong hits.
